Head YouTek IG Extreme Pro
$190.00
Released January, 2011
The Pros:Comfortable and effective when shooting from the baseline. Capable of generating a high degree of spin. Not cumbersome, despite its heavy frame.
The Cons:Not particularly comfortable or maneuverable at the net. Response is somewhat dampened due to its neck stiffness.
The Head YouTek IG Extreme Pro is a tennis racket built to be heavy and stiff for strong power return, but with a slightly head-light balance to maintain strong control. This resembles the Head YouTek IG Extreme MP, but the weight has been increased to 11.1 ounces to enable more powerful hits.

The balance remains almost the same, however, at 1 1/3 inches head-light, enabling players to move the racket where it needs to be more easily. Combined with the large head size of 100 square inches and a 16/19 string pattern, this enables players to put a lot of spin on the ball easily. Both rackets use Innegra technology which reduces vibration by 17% and makes the racket more stable.
Features
- Innegra technology
- Colors: black/yellow
- Weight: 315 g, 11.1 oz
- Beam: 24/26/23 mm
- Head size: 645 cm2, 100 sq in
- Balance: 310 mm, 1 1/3 in HL
- Length: 685 mm, 27 in
- Grip size: 1 to 5
- String pattern: 16/19
- Swingstyle: L3
